为啥只能产生一行数据
<%
rs.movefirst
if rs("XuHao")<>"" then
x=rs("XuHao")
end if
y=rs.movelast
if rs("XuHao")<>"" then
y=rs("XuHao")
else
rs.moveprevious
if rs("XuHao")<>"" then
y=rs("XuHao")
end if
end if
i=1
do
rs.movefirst
Randomize Timer
a=Int((y-x+1)*Rnd+x)
do while not rs.eof
if rs("XuHao")=a then
strz="<tr><td width=25>"&i&"</td><td width=40><p align=center><input type=" & "'" & "checkbox" & "'" & " name=" & "'" & "C2" & "'" & " value=" & "'" & "ON" & "'" & "></p></td><td>" & rs("ShiTi")
rs.movenext
if rs("XuHao")="" then
strz=strz&rs("ShiTi")&"</td></tr>"
else
strz=strz&"</td></tr>"
end if
response.write strz
exit do
else
rs.movenext
end if
loop
i=i+1
strShuLiang=strShuLiang-1
loop while strShuLian=1
%>
问题点数:0、回复次数:0Top
相关问题
- 请教:如何一行一行的向打印机打印数据,既每产生一行数据打印一次,但不分页
- dataView的addNew()怎么只能添加一行数据呢?帮帮小妹吧
- 帮忙看看这个递归错在哪里?数据只能出来一行
- datagrid中,如何使第一行之后的新产生的一行的数据,某些字段的值与上一行的一致
- MSHFlexGrid1 取某一行数据
- 这段程序有什么毛病,为什么打印时只能打印第一行数据?
- 一行数据改成多行数据.
- 如何在数据窗口中(grid 型)的第一行加一条 非本数据窗口的 select语句所产生的记录,
- listbox中多行内容插入数据库,但只能存入除第一行以外的数据,第一行的内容存不进去,请大家帮忙啊
- MYSQL 选取唯一的一行数据




